Step 4: Configure the lint credentials for Proseguard. Before running the documentation linter against the Fennwick style service, create a file named .env in the repo root. The linter authenticates to the style API on every run, so this value must be present before step 5. Add the following line to your .env file now.

secret setting of hawep-yahig: LEDGER_TOKEN29=41b5d6315371c92885eaeb077fb63

### Action Item: Spoolhaven Retry Storm

From last Tuesday's outage: the Spoolhaven print service retried failed jobs without backoff, saturating the render pool. Fix merged; retries now use capped exponential backoff with jitter. Owner will monitor for a week before closing. The agreed retry constants are recorded below.

constants for yadup-kajof:
RATE_LIMITS = {
    "zorwyn": 1,
    "druwyn": 1,
}

Mintlark previously rounded converted amounts at each intermediate step, which produced sub-cent drift on multi-hop conversions between low-denomination currencies. As of 2.9.0, conversion is carried at eight decimal places internally and rounded once at presentation, using banker's rounding by default. Contractors touching the ledger service should note that older snapshots were written under the old scheme; the reconciliation job handles the delta. The conversion service now ships with these defaults.

settings of tagef-bawif:
DRUIX_HOST=druix.zemvarlabs.internal
DRUIX_PORT=8000

Ticket: DEDUP-412 — Connection failures during customer record dedup

The Larkspur dedup job started failing overnight with pool exhaustion errors. It merges duplicate customer records in batches of 500, but the batch worker isn't releasing connections after a merge conflict, so the pool drains within twenty minutes. Proposed fix: wrap merges in a try/finally release and cap retries at three. For the sync, reproduce against staging using the connection string below.

primary connection of bagep-kaweg = clickhouse://rusdor_svc:3TXlgH7O8DuUYI@db-ae3f.zarqelgrid.internal:5432/zordor